Keyboard Shortcuts

Opterius Mail supports a comprehensive set of keyboard shortcuts for power users. Shortcuts let you navigate, read, compose, and manage mail without touching the mouse. Most shortcuts are single keys or two-key sequences.

Viewing the Shortcut Overlay

Press ? at any time to open the keyboard shortcut overlay — a full-screen reference card showing all available shortcuts, organized by category. Press ? again or press Escape to close it.

Navigation

Use these shortcuts to move between sections of Opterius Mail:

Shortcut Action
G then I Go to Inbox
G then S Go to Sent
G then D Go to Drafts
G then T Go to Trash
G then A Go to Archive folder
G then C Go to Contacts
G then K Go to Settings
/ Focus the search bar
Escape Close modal, overlay, or go back

Message List

These shortcuts work when focus is on the message list:

Shortcut Action
J or Move selection down to next message
K or Move selection up to previous message
Enter or O Open selected message
X Select / deselect the highlighted message
Ctrl+A Select all messages on current page
* then A Select all messages in the folder
* then N Deselect all
* then R Select all read messages
* then U Select all unread messages
* then S Select all starred messages

Reading Mail

These shortcuts work when a message is open:

Shortcut Action
R Reply to sender
A Reply all
F Forward
U Mark as unread and return to list
S Star / unstar (toggle \Flagged)
E Archive (move to Archive folder)
Delete or # Delete (move to Trash)
Shift+Delete Permanently delete (skip Trash)
V Open "Move to folder" picker
L Open "Copy to folder" picker
N Next message in list
P Previous message in list
Z Undo last action (where supported)
Shift+U Mark as unread without closing
Shift+I Mark as read

Composing

These shortcuts work in the compose window or anywhere to start composing:

Shortcut Action
C Open new compose window
Ctrl+Enter Send the current message
Ctrl+S Save as draft
Ctrl+B Bold selected text in editor
Ctrl+I Italic selected text in editor
Ctrl+U Underline selected text in editor
Ctrl+K Insert link in editor
Escape Close compose / prompt to save draft
Tab Confirm current recipient chip and move to next field

Folder Actions

Shortcut Action
Shift+C Create new folder
Shift+E Edit / rename selected folder (in folder manager)

Tips for Using Shortcuts Effectively

Two-key sequences: Shortcuts like G then I (go to Inbox) use a "prefix + key" pattern. Press G first — the status bar briefly shows "Go to..." — then press the second key within 1 second. If you wait too long, the sequence times out.

Focus requirements: Most shortcuts require the keyboard focus to be on the main webmail content area, not inside a text field. If you are typing in a search box, input field, or the compose editor, letter shortcuts like R and D will type into the field rather than trigger the action. Press Escape to leave the text field, then use the shortcut.

Compose shortcuts in the editor: When you are inside the TipTap compose editor, most navigation shortcuts are inactive (to allow normal typing). Formatting shortcuts like Ctrl+B work in the editor.

Customizing shortcuts: Shortcut customization is not available in the current version. All shortcuts are fixed.

Browser Conflicts

Some browser or OS shortcuts may conflict with Opterius Mail's shortcuts:

Conflict Solution
Ctrl+A (browser: address bar focus) Click into the message list first
Delete (browser: back navigation on some browsers) This should not conflict in a web app context
F (Firefox: find in page if using legacy shortcuts) Disable browser find shortcut in browser settings

If a shortcut you expect to work is not responding, check whether a browser extension is intercepting it. Try in an incognito/private window to rule out extensions.
